Lamb's quarters—leaves and shoots, raw, also prevents erosion, also distracts leaf miners from nearby crops. Nettle—young leaves collected before flowering used as a tea or spinach substitute. Plants have use as compost material or for fibre. Purslane—prepared raw for salads or sautéed.

In the traditional Austrian medicine Plantago lanceolata leaves have been used internally (as syrup or tea) or externally (fresh leaves) for treatment of disorders of the respiratory tract, skin, insect bites, and infections. Medicinal plants, also called medicinal herbs, have been discovered and used in traditional medicine practices since prehistoric times. Plants synthesize hundreds of chemical compounds for various functions, including defense and protection against insects , fungi , diseases , against parasites [ 2 ] and herbivorous mammals .

The Medicinal Botanical Garden of Lima (Spanish: Jardín botánico de Plantas Medicinales de Lima) is a botanical garden for medicinal plants in Jesús María District, Lima, Peru. It is located next to the headquarters of the Ministry of Health , [ 2 ] [ 3 ] with another garden located at Chorrillos District .
